4.2 Electrical Wiring of the Loudspeaker Network
NOTE: Special care should be taken with the network electrical connection. Improper electrical
installation can damage the amplifier or result in a bad masking sound in the room. The connection
schematics in this section must be carried out as specified, otherwise the acoustical or electrical
performance may be compromised.
4.2.1 Power Taps:
Figure 11 : SMS-25V rotary switch
The loudspeakers are equipped with a rotary switch that can be used to change the power tap on
the speakers. 4W, 2W, 1W, 0.5W taps are available for a 25-volt input.
We recommend the use of the 2W tap as a default value. The 2W tap allows up to 32 loudspeakers
to be installed on each line and ensures a sound pressure level of 85 dB at 1 meter (free field)
which is adequate for paging. If paging is not required for the installation, the 1W tap will be
sufficient to ensure the desired target masking sound in typical installations. In this case, more
loudspeakers can be installed on each channel of the SmartSMS unit. The 0.5W tap should only be
used to lower the volume for an individual loudspeaker (see below).

Power taps can be used as an individual volume control for loudspeakers. Using a lower tap will
attenuate the masking sound level by 3 dB. This can be used in some situations, where one
loudspeaker is louder than the others in an zone (for example when the loudspeaker is installed
above an air return grill). If the tap is changed from 2W to 1W, the loudspeaker will be 3 dB lower.
